When I came to Madinah, sickness was occurring in the city and they were dying quickly. I sat with 'Umar bin al Khattab ؓ and a funeral passed by, Good things were said about (the deceased) and ‘Umar ؓ said: It is due. Then another (funeral) passed by; good things were said about (the deceased) and he said: It is due. Then a third funeral passed by: bad things were said about the deceased and ‘Umar said: It is due. I said: What is due, O Ameer al Mu'mineen? He said: I said what the Messenger of Allah ﷺ said: ʿAny Muslim in whose favour four people testify, Allah will admit him to Paradise.ʿ We said: Or three? He said: “Or three.ʿ We said: Or two? He said: ʿOr two.” Then we did not ask him about one, (Using translation from Aḥmad 204)
